关于Eclipse的Axis2插件的安装

最近因要做基于AXIS2的Web Service相关项目的工作,下载了Eclipse3.4,在MyEclipse的主页上找了半天也没有找到Eclipse3.4的插件安装版,主页上的MyEclipse for Eclipse3.4下载下来一看,竟然属于IN-ALL版本,实在不爽,一气之下在Eclipse中在线升级了MyEclipse7.0,接下来的工作是安装AXIS2的代码生成插件"axis2-eclipse-codegen-wizard",和服务打包插件"axis2-eclipse-service-archiver-wizard",这两个插件是否不支持LINKS安装,无赖只好将解压后的文件夹拷贝到plugins目录中,启动Eclipse很顺利,可是在使用codegen插件来从JAVA接口生成WSDL文件时,到了最后一步竟然出然了"An error occurred while completing process -java.lang.reflect.InvocationTargetException"的错误,重试N次,结果依然,于是寄托google寻求答案,找到b了http://blog.chinaunix.net/u2/80855/showart_1226778.html这个帖子,颀喜若狂,真的是希望越大,失望越大,身心再次受到无情的摧殘,因为不管我怎么试问题依然如故(注:该帖子中提供的两个插件下载地址已经不可用,现在可用的插件地址:http://apache.justdn.org/ws/axis2/tools/1_4_1/,下载下来的版本应该是1.3.0),郁闷良久,不过,在我快要放弃的时候竟然让我找到了此问题的解决办法"http://mail-archives.apache.org/mod_mbox/ws-axis-user/200810.mbox/<48E46809.4020400@wso2.com>",过程如下:从AXIS2的LIB库中复制"geronimo-stax-api_1.0_spec-1.0.1.jar"和"backport-util-concurrent-3.1.jar"文件到Codegen的lib目录中,同时修改plugin.xml文件,添加

<library name="lib/geronimo-stax-api_1.0_spec-1.0.1.jar"> 
         <export name="*"/> 
</library> 
<library name="lib/backport-util-concurrent-3.1.jar"> 
        <export name="*"/> 
</library>

到plugin.xml文件中,保存后重新启动EC即可!我想在插件下一个版本中应该会修复这个问题吧!

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值